## FAQ — LiftPath Simulator Access

**Q: I'm locked out of the LiftPath dispatch simulator. What now?**

A: Contractor accounts on the Torvane cluster expire after thirty days of inactivity. To restore access, open the simulator's recovery console and select the sandbox tenant, not production. The console will then prompt for the recovery passphrase, which is kept directly below this entry.

vault phrase of bagaf-kajeg = jorath-feniel-briir-siliel-ralix

Quarterly Planning Note — Reseller Programme

For the board: the Pelwyn Partner Programme enters phase two next quarter. Twelve resellers signed in the pilot regions; channel revenue reached 9% of total, ahead of plan. We will add a certified tier, tighten margin bands, and expand into the Caldmere territory. Headcount request: two channel managers. The confidential outlook follows directly below.

board note of fafog-yahap: Project Rusdor slips by a full year because of the audit delay.

Handover Note — Southmoor Regional Sales Review

To the sales leads, from outgoing director Alden Rourke to incoming director Ines Calloway: this note summarizes where the Southmoor review stands. Pipeline coverage is at 2.1x, slightly below our comfort threshold, and the Ferrow account remains the largest renewal risk this quarter. Ines will inherit the open pricing discussion with the Tarnby distributors; please give her full context in your one-on-ones. Read the confidential note below before your first team meeting.

management briefing: Project Ulavan slips by two quarters because of the staffing delay.

Handover note — static-analysis baseline. The baseline file for Lintrock suppresses roughly 400 legacy findings in the Quarrel monorepo; don't regenerate it without sign-off from Priya's team. New findings must be fixed, not added to the baseline. Regeneration steps and the exception process are documented on the internal wiki page here.

wiki page, tahaf-tajog: https://jira.ordindyn.corp/pipeline